From Raw Glass to High-Value Products: Core Machines and Innovations
Exceptional results begin with precise cutting. Eworld Machine’s cutting tables and automatic loading systems stabilize float glass, apply optimized nesting algorithms, and deliver clean edges with minimal micro‑chipping. Servo-driven axes and intelligent pressure control protect coatings and reduce scrap, while integrated break-out systems maintain line speed without sacrificing quality. From there, double edgers and vertical edging machines refine geometry for tight assemblies, producing consistent arrises and finished edges that reduce field failures.
For fabrication flexibility, drilling and milling centers pair rigid frames with high-speed spindles and smart lubrication, enabling accurate holes, slots, and notches even on tempered-ready parts. CNC work centers extend this capability to complex contours, combining multi‑axis motion with intuitive programming so operators can switch from one-off prototypes to high-volume runs with minimal setup. Washers equipped with stainless processing paths, adjustable brushes, and filtered water circuits prepare glass for downstream bonding, laminating, or coating without introducing contaminants that can undermine adhesion or optical clarity.
Thermal processes are engineered for consistency and efficiency. Tempering furnaces use well-balanced convection, zone-controlled heating, and real-time feedback to manage thick-to-thin transitions and coated panes. Laminating lines integrate precise de‑airing, staged heating, and pressure profiles to produce clear, durable laminates with strong interlayer bonding. Insulating glass lines automate spacer application, gas filling, and sealing, with optional vision systems that verify alignment and seal integrity. Across the portfolio, energy-conscious designs—heat recovery, variable-speed drives, and water recycling—help plants meet sustainability goals without trading off performance.
